          Recently one my friend cheated around 1c in my friends circle, different friend tried different approaches.

          1) Police Complaint – Police simple get written statement that he will pay in 6 months, but every 6 months they will renew the agreement but police will not force him to pay.

          2) Filling a case – he have all the setup to file personal bankruptcy, case will be dismissed saying he is bankrupt, but still few lawyer willing to file case to make some quick cash though case cannot be won.

          3) Bringing goon or politician – they charge 15k per visit whether they are able or not able to recover.

          4) Tried visiting his house in early morning – he and his family is not ashamed after few visits, even by 6am there will be a huge queue in front of his house(Credit cards, personal loan, nbfc loan, local lenders etc)

          I am sure he will never flee the scene because then you can file fraud case, also you cannot harsh him then he can file a case against you.
